Emei's unsheathing is more than just "striving for success"

They didn't know that during those few years, there was a project with the code name "Emei" in the southwest, which was in the process of passing the most difficult gate of hell.

Turbofan-15, this name is easy to pronounce immediately, but behind it is how many test runs have gone through and how many chief engineers have turned gray hair. Thirty years have passed since the demonstration was launched in the 1990s, to the core machine being ignited in 2005, and now to being actually installed on the J-20A and conducting batch test flights.

What exactly does "super evolution" mean? It is not as easy as just increasing the thrust from 13 tons to 18.5 tons. What’s really scary about it is that not only do we avoid the paths taken by others, but we also take our own unique gait.

You see, the serrations on the tail nozzle are not just for a good-looking appearance, but to promote infrared stealth to a higher level; you have heard ridicule about the "thick neck" design, which is not filled with excess fat, but more advanced avionics equipment and more fuel.
